School of Communication - [SOC] is situated in Manipal, Karnataka, India, and is recognized for its integrated and contemporary facilities tailored for communication and media studies. The vibrant campus features large academic spaces, AC classrooms, a comprehensive learning infrastructure, and a dynamic student life supported by hostels, sports areas, and innovative media labs.

School of Communication - [SOC] Facilities: Central Library

The Central Library at SOC serves as a crucial resource hub, providing an extensive collection of print and digital materials. Students engage in coursework and research with access to both traditional texts and cutting-edge digital archives. The space is designed to encourage independent learning, group study, and digital research with Wi-Fi access across the library area.

 

School of Communication - [SOC] Facilities: Other Facilities

SOC, Manipal offers a blend of specialized and general amenities supporting academic and daily life. Facilities are thoughtfully designed to promote student comfort, accessibility, and practical experience in communication technology. All classrooms are equipped with smartboards and audio-visual systems, while the entire campus enjoys robust Wi-Fi connectivity.

  • Air-conditioned smart classrooms with projection technology

  • Seminar halls and a dedicated auditorium

  • Food courts and canteens serving varied cuisines

  • Campus-wide Wi-Fi, common recreation spaces, and relaxation zones

  • 24x7 electricity and water supply in academic and residential blocks

 

School of Communication - [SOC] Facilities: Sports & Recreation

SOC students have access to a wide array of sports and recreational facilities on the Manipal campus, notably the Marena Indoor Sports Complex. Fitness and wellness are prioritized, with multiple opportunities to participate in both indoor and outdoor sports.

  • Badminton, basketball, squash, cricket, football, tennis courts

  • Fully equipped modern gymnasium

  • Access to swimming pool (NA for SOC-specific pool)

  • Student recreation lounges and open grounds

 

School of Communication - [SOC] Facilities: Innovation & Research

An ecosystem of creativity and advancement is nurtured at SOC through its State-of-the-art Innovation Centre and dedicated media labs. Students gain practical skills in broadcast, production, digital design, and research, ensuring an industry-oriented learning approach.

  • Television studios with multicamera production and PCR

  • On-air community radio station

  • Mac and Windows-based editing suites for non-linear editing

  • Professional HD cameras, studio lights, and audio workstations

  • Licensed design and post-production software

 

School of Communication - [SOC] Hostel Facilities

On-campus student living is designed to provide comfort, safety, and a supportive community. Hostel accommodation is available for both male and female students with various room types and amenities. Residential life is structured to foster personal growth, interaction, and security, supported by 24x7 utilities and round-the-clock Wi-Fi connectivity.

  • Well-furnished rooms (single, double, multi-sharing options)

  • Access to gyms, recreation spaces, and common lounges

  • Mess and canteen services with multiple meal options

  • Laundry facilities and cleaning services

  • CCTV surveillance and secure entry

 

School of Communication - [SOC] Events & Festivals

SOC hosts and participates in a spectrum of cultural, academic, and media events that energize student life and foster industry interaction. Annual festivals, talent hunts, and media fests allow students to showcase creative prowess and build professional networks within an engaging campus environment.

  • VIBES—Annual Media Fest (journalism, broadcasting, advertising competitions)

  • Workshops and guest lectures by industry professionals

  • Club activities (photography, film, radio, literature)

  • Student-run news productions and radio broadcasts

  • Sports tournaments and intra-campus competitions
